A small wayside devotional shrine rests inside an arched wall niche beside a weathered wooden door and exposed brickwork. The recessed alcove holds sacred figurines and simple offerings, creating the feel of a neighborhood place of prayer where faith is kept visible in daily life. The worn plaster, aged masonry, and humble arrangement speak to long-standing Christian devotion outside formal sanctuary walls.
The subject reflects the historic practice of placing roadside or household shrines as reminders of God’s presence, intercession, and gratitude.
